McKay Readies Run Against Naughton

Parks director schedules fundraiser.

Town Parks Director Don McKay has scheduled a fundraiser for Feb. 11 in his campaign to unseat highway superintendent Willliam J. Naughton, a fellow Democrat.

McKay, who was appointed to the parks job in 1995, formerly worked as a reporter and later as an aide to Steve Israel when he served on the Town Board. He also served as public information for the town before taking over the parks job. McKay is a 1983 graduate of Northport High School.

The term is for four years.

Tickets for the fundraiser at Jellyfish run from $150 to $1,000. The event runs from 5 to 8 p.m.

The Huntington Town Democratic Committee is inviting those interested in running for supervisor, town board or highway superintendent to notify the committee by Feb. 8.
